Celebrations as nursery gains Outstanding Ofsted result!


Wednesday 18th November saw the Mayor of St Ives, Yvonne Watson, attending Castle Kids Nursery at Tregenna Castle for the official opening of the facility. The Mayor was also there to celebrate the result of the nursery’s recent Ofsted inspection. Inspectors visited Castle Kids in October to carry out the nursery’s first inspection and to the delight of the nursery’s management, staff, parents and children the report grades the nursery as “Outstanding.” Ofsted inspectors grade settings as outstanding, good, satisfactory or inadequate. Only the top 3% of settings in the country achieve an outstanding status.

Castle Kids becomes one of the first nurseries in Cornwall to achieve the outstanding status in every category under new inspection criteria, a tremendous achievement given that the nursery has been open for a mere four months.

Leah Care, manager of Castle Kids said: "We are all delighted and extremely proud of our achievements and the feedback we have received from Ofsted. This is all due to the hard work and dedication of the staff team and the contribution of the children and parents."

The report states: “The overall quality of the provision is Outstanding. Castle Kids provides excellent standards of care and education for all children attending. The manager is highly skilled and all staff are committed to the principles of the Early Years Foundation Stage.” The full report can be viewed on the Ofsted website at www.ofsted.gov.uk

Castle Kids is the latest fully Ofsted registered day care facility to open in St Ives. The facility is designed to meet the needs of the hotel guests and local parents alike in providing flexible, affordable, high quality day care, offering children the chance to learn through play in a stimulating and nurturing environment. It also provides a facility for parents to get to know other people and new parents in the area and to drop in for advice and social opportunities.

The nursery conforms to the Early Years Foundation guidelines, but operates on a drop-in basis. This makes the nursery both very flexible and affordable as parents need not pay for sessions which are either cancelled or not attended due to sickness or holiday. Its also great for those needing an hour to themselves to go to the gym, get a hairdo or maybe just have some “me time”.

In addition to the extremely well equipped nursery, children attending Castle Kids also benefit from the supervised use of the two swimming pools on site, not to mention the sub-tropical gardens, adventure playground and vast open spaces the grounds provide. Ages catered for range from new born babies to children aged 10 and there are stimulating activities geared towards each age group.
